Pinnipera

Pinnipera is a small rocky planet in the Bloo System, named after the abundance of native pinnipeds. The planet has two continents, one on either Pole. Oceans are covered in ice, particularly around major landmasses.

Pinnipera has no native sophonts, instead occupied by Razhea Capita. The planet is protected by law, no unauthorised personnel allowed to land on Pinnipera. Just a handful of scientists have clearance for landing, operating in a number of research facilities dotted around the globe.

Research Outposts

Razhean scientists have a tough time handling the sub-zero temperatures and dangerous weather conditions. Both continents suffer from frequent seismic activity, expansive geyser fields, ice sheets shifting, and a number of dangerous lifeforms.

The various research stations set up around Pinnipera study the planet from top to bottom, core to crust. Climatologists are studying the ever decreasing temperatures of the planet - the last thousand years suggest Pinnipera is entering a new ice age.

All outposts have resident exobiologists to study the native lifeforms. Sawspine seals are being extensively studied, as they are the only known pinniped on the planet to lay eggs.
